Subject: Cut-over complete — Wrenkit component library now on semantic-release

Team,

The Wrenkit shared component library has been fully cut over to automated semantic versioning as of last night. All consuming apps now resolve versions through the internal registry rather than pinned git tags. Future maintainers: do not hand-bump versions; the release pipeline derives them from commit messages. For reference, the registry and release pipeline are driven entirely by the configuration below.

deployment values, yadug-bawif:
[framir]
team = pelox
access_code = ac_a38ab2
owner = tamion.julael
host = framir.tolvaqlabs.test
port = 11211
peer = tammir.zemvargrid.local
salt = 2215ef03
pin = 1541

Gross-Margin Review — Managers Only (Sales Leads), Corvane Supply Co.

Q2 margins slipped to 41% from 44%. Drivers: discounting on the Ashfield accounts and higher freight. Actions: discount approvals now require regional sign-off; freight surcharge pilot starts next month. Full figures in the finance workspace. The confidential business-plan note follows below.

confidential, kagep-kahof: Druokax Systems plans to lower the Ulaath list price by 53 percent in March.

Alert: BILLWORK-BLUEGREEN-DRIFT. This fires when the blue and green pools of the Ledgerline billing worker run different schema versions for more than ten minutes mid-deploy. Plugin webhooks may see mixed payload shapes during the window — handle both or buffer events. Usually self-resolves once traffic cuts over; if it doesn't, the deploy is stuck. To report payload mismatches during a cutover, write to the address below.

escalation mailbox, hadug-bajog: sormir@norvalabs.internal

Subject: Key rotation for Routewise assignment service

Hi Devika,

As part of reviewing PR #882 (the revised driver-assignment heuristic that weights idle time over proximity), please note we rotated the Routewise staging credential this morning. The old key stops working Friday at noon. Your local test harness will need the replacement before the heuristic's integration suite will pass. The new key is included below for convenience.

app token of tagef-tafog = qvz3-7n0